Cruach Achadh na Craoibhe

Cruach Achadh na Craoibhe is a hill in , , and has an elevation of 909 feet. Cruach Achadh na Craoibhe is situated nearby to the hamlet , as well as near the locality .

Cruach Achadh na Craoibhe

Latitude
56.37471° or 56° 22′ 29″ north
Longitude
-5.20251° or 5° 12′ 9″ west
Elevation
909 feet (277 metres)
